18.9% of Farmington, MS residents had an income below the poverty level in 2022, which was about the same as the poverty level of 19.1% across the entire state of Mississippi. 15.8% of high school graduates and 18.0% of non high school graduates live in poverty. The poverty rate was 15.1% among disabled residents. The renting rate among poor residents was 51.9%. For comparison, it was 18.6% among residents with income above the poverty level.
